Baseball wins rainy, high scoring affair to sweep series with Lourdes

Tuesday afternoon was a chilly, rainy early March day, but that did not stop the Spring Arbor baseball team from playing their 7th game in as many days, as they took on Lourdes in the final game of an extended three game set. The series began last Tuesday with a doubleheader sweep from the Cougars in two close contests, and this game was no different, albeit more of an offensive outburst. The two teams combined for 21 runs, with a 3 run Spring Arbor 8th inning giving them the knockout punch in a 12-9 win.

GAME HIGHLIGHTS
 Kyler Hinken got the start in a scheduled bullpen day for Spring Arbor and threw a scoreless first in his only inning of work. The Cougar offense immediately got to work after that, scoring 3 runs on an errant throw on a double steal from Aiden Brunin and Joey Tessmer that allowed Tessmer to score, and a Braydon Gregory 2 RBI single. 
 
Lourdes would respond quickly in the top of the second on a home run to right field, to cut their deficit to 3-2, but Tessmer hit a long ball of his own to right center in the bottom of the frame to get a run back for the Cougars and give them the 4-2 advantage after 2 innings. 
 
Freshmen Brady Mitchell was the next arm out of the pen for the Cougars and was stellar in the top of the third, striking out the side with a measly infield single preventing a 1-2-3 inning. In the bottom of the frame, the Cougar offense came to life once again, with Connor Dee scoring on an errant throw as a result of a Zach Adams sac bunt, and Jake Spedoske bringing another run home on a safety squeeze bunt to extend Spring Arbor's lead to 6-2. Lourdes would continue to respond however in the top of the fourth, as the Gray Wolves used a pair of bunts, sac flies, and a Cougar error to bring 3 runs across and get within a run, 6-5. 

Spring Arbor would go scoreless in the bottom of the fourth, their first scoreless inning of the contest, and Lourdes would capitalize on that momentum, taking a 7-6 lead on a fluky wild pitch play that brought two runs across. However, Joey Tessmer continued to make his presence known in the bottom of the fifth, tying it up at 7 apiece with a 2-strike, 2-out RBI double. Lourdes would retake the lead in the top of the sixth, 8-7, after two straight Cougar errors allowed a run to score, and Spring Arbor could not immediately respond, going scoreless in the bottom of the sixth. 
 
Desperately needing a clean inning, Josh Murphy got the call from the bullpen for Spring Arbor in the top of the seventh and answered the call with a scoreless frame. The Cougar offense found a spark again in the bottom half, regaining the lead, 9-8,  on a wild pitch that scored pinch runner Brenden Phillips, and an RBI walk from Landon Raczkowski with two outs. Another Lourdes home run retied the score at 9 apiece in the top of the eighth, but as they did all day, the Cougar offense responded. After two walks to begin the inning, Zach Adams delivered the big blow, lacing a double into right center on a full count pitch to bring home two. Tessmer would record another RBI on a single up the middle to give the Cougars a 12-9 lead that they would not relinquish, as Murphy struck out the side in the ninth to seal the third straight victory for the Cougars.
